Pre-heat the oven to 220c / 240c non-fan assisted / gas mark 7
Scrub the potatoes and pop them in the oven for 1 hour, turning them half way through
To test, take out a potato with a tea towel and squeeze gently - it is cooked when it feels soft. Keep the oven on
When they are cool enough to handle, cut them in half and spoon out the soft flesh from the skin into a bowl. Add a knob of butter or glug of olive oil and mash till smooth
While the jackets cook, prepare your ingredients for the filling - chop all the remaining vegetables into small pieces
First fry the onion with the mixed herbs for a few minutes
Add the mince if using and cook until browned, then add all of the remaining ingredients and simmer for 15 mins until it thickens
Fill each potato half with your sauce, top with mash and sprinkle with grated cheese
Pop back in the oven for 10 mins until the cheese looks melted and golden
